Specializations
Inflammatory Skin Conditions
The investigator specializes in treating moderate to severe plaque psoriasis, conducting extensive research into novel therapeutic approaches for this chronic inflammatory condition.
- Plaque Psoriasis Management
- Long-term Disease Control
- Treatment Response Assessment
Their work includes evaluating innovative treatment options and monitoring long-term safety profiles in psoriasis care.
Autoimmune Dermatology
Focused on advancing treatment for cutaneous lupus erythematosus and bullous pemphigoid, with particular attention to cases resistant to conventional therapies.
- Subacute and Chronic Cutaneous Lupus
- Bullous Pemphigoid Treatment
- Autoimmune Skin Disease Management
The investigator explores novel therapeutic approaches for complex autoimmune dermatological conditions.
Allergic Skin Disorders
Expertise in treating chronic urticaria and atopic dermatitis, investigating both spontaneous and inducible forms of these conditions.
- Chronic Spontaneous Urticaria
- Chronic Inducible Urticaria
- Moderate to Severe Atopic Dermatitis
Their research encompasses various therapeutic approaches for allergic skin manifestations.
